Robert Jenrick joins Reform UK after being sacked by Conservatives

Robert Jenrick was unveiled by Nigel Farage at a press conference after being sacked for secretly plotting to defect; he cited migration and national security concerns.

  • On Thursday, Robert Jenrick joined Reform UK, unveiled by leader Nigel Farage at a Westminster press conference.
  • Conservative leader Kemi Badenoch suspended Robert Jenrick and removed the whip after citing 'irrefutable evidence' he was plotting to defect, with party sources noting documents including a speech and media plan left 'lying around'.
  • Robert Jenrick said failures on migration and justice drove his move, criticizing rising migration, court backlogs, 'overflowing' prisons and a small army, adding both Labour Party and Conservative Party broke Britain.
  • Nigel Farage welcomed Jenrick and thanked Kemi Badenoch, saying he would 'buy Kemi lunch next week' and highlighting Jenrick's 60% approval rating as a boost to realign the centre-right.
  • A string of Tory defections has bolstered Reform UK, with Lord Offord, Nadhim Zahawi, Dame Andrea Jenkyns, Jonathan Gullis and Nadine Dorries joining, while Kevin Hollinrake called Jenrick's move 'treacherous'.
